Transaction e62fa870ca1a3f48b415331c2bc407371a1605cd90cd4632468d77bc4c24b2c8
1 Input
1 Output
-
e62fa870ca1a3f48b415331c2bc407371a1605cd90cd4632468d77bc4c24b2c8:0
- value
- 379551
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5c48a35b8b3c54d8d0d58e3a5d70701b702c1f5
- address
- bc1q6hzg5ddck0z5mrgdtr36t4c8qxms9s04pjuzld